Faith: today we looked at several bible readings. look:
Romans 8:9 : "You, however, are controlled not by the sinful nature but by the Spirit, if the Spirit of God lives in you. And if anyone does not have the Spirit of Christ, he does not belong to Christ."
Romans 8:15-16 : "For you did not receive a spirit that makes you a slave again to fear, but you received the Spirit of sonship. And by him we cry, "Abba, Father." The Spirit himself testifies with our spirit that we are God's children."
Galations 5:22-23 : "But the fruit of the Spirit is love, joy, peace, patience, kindness, goodness, faithfulness, gentleness and self-control. Against such things there is no law."
When you have a faith (i'm still trying to find mine) the Spirit lives in you and controls you (not in a bad way!). If you dont believe then you dont belong to Him. This doesnt mean he's deserted you it just means that he just doesnt want to force you into believing in him if you dont want to.
whatever you choose to do he will still love you and look after you. in his eyes we are his children, so we are all brothers and sisters (no wonder he asks us to love one another).
The fruits of the Spirit are given to us if we ask to help us become better people day in day out. Only ask and he will give. Well done for blogging so honestly about the pressure you’re under.
Part of the reason people try and get us to join in with stuff we know is wrong is to make them feel better about doing it themselves. Your saying ‘no’ may make them feel bad – which is why they pressure you.
Sometimes people will respect you for sticking to your principles – although they might think your principles are weird. And you can have a good friendship with someone who has different values to you. But sometimes you have to accept that some people are not worth hanging around with if being with them makes you cry.
I will pray for you – to be true to your principles and to find other people around you who will support you when you need it.
